Protective overglove for glove-box gloves
Abstract
Apparatus and associated methods relate to a protective overglove configured to be worn over a glove-box glove, the protective overglove having a hand portion and a gauntlet portion extending from the hand portion to a cuff portion, the cuff portion having a locking device to attach the cuff portion to the overglove at an upper-arm region of a user. In an illustrative example, the overglove may have a protective material to protect a user's arm from a hazard presented within a glove-box. In some embodiments, the protective material may include non-woven fibers of high-tenacity. In an exemplary embodiment, the non-woven fibers may include Ultra-High-Molecular-Weight Poly-Ethylene (UHMWPE) fibers. In some embodiments, the locking device may include a hook and loop fastener. In an exemplary embodiment, the protective overglove may advantageously protect the integrity of the glove-box glove from a hazard presented within a glove-box.

1 . A protective overglove configured to fit over a glove-box glove worn by a user when the user inserts the user's arm into the glove box glove to access an interior of a glove box, the protective overglove comprising:
a hand portion configured to fit over a hand portion of the glove-box glove when worn by the user, the hand portion of the protective overglove comprising a protective material configured to provide protection against a hazard presented within a glove-box; a gauntlet portion extending from the hand portion of the protective overglove to a cuff portion of the protective overglove, the gauntlet portion configured to provide continuous protective coverage from the hand portion to the cuff portion over the glove-box glove; and a securing device configured to removably secure the cuff portion of the protective overglove to the glove-box glove at an upper-arm region of the user when worn, wherein the securing device is configured to be hand operated by the user wearing the glove-box glove, wherein the protective material comprises a non-woven fabric of high-tenacity fibers, the fibers being bonded together first mechanically by needle punch and then thermally by calendaring, the fabric weighing between 200 g/m 2 and 400 g/m 2 .
2 . The protective overglove of claim 1 , wherein the securing device comprises a hook and loop fastener.
3 . The protective overglove of claim 1 , wherein the nonwoven fabric comprises Ultra-High-Molecular-Weight Poly-Ethylene (UHMWPE) fibers.
4 . The protective overglove of claim 1 , wherein the non-woven fabric has a thickness between 1.4 mm and 2.4 mm.
